Carte des Royaumes de Siam, de Tunquin, Pegu, Ava, Aracan &c.
c.1755
Cambodia,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, Thailand, Vietnam
The kingdoms of mid-18th century mainland Southeast Asia are shown on this map: Ava and Pegu (Myanmar), Siam (Thailand), Tonquin and Cochinchine (Vietnam), Camboie (Cambodia) and Laos. The text is in French, with the title also in Dutch at the base.
